Marcelo Mayer is establishing himself as a significant player for the Boston Red Sox, not just for his power but for a combination of elite defense and hitting skills. In his early days in the big leagues in 2023, Mayer has demonstrated his potential with notable performances like his recent two-homer game against the Tampa Bay Rays, contributing significantly to his team's success. His abilities have drawn attention, marking him as a potential franchise shortstop for the future as he joins an exclusive group of young players making impactful starts.
Effortless, manager Alex Cora said postgame of Mayer, per MassLive's Chris Cotillo. He's not trying. Obviously, trying to hit the ball hard. But he's able to go the other way... It's a complete at-bat.
Mayer's two round-trippers at Fenway Park gave Boston the offense it needed to secure both a 4-3 win over Tampa and a second straight series victory over an AL East opponent.
